This course provides essential skills in network security, troubleshooting, and preparation for certification exams. You will gain a deep understanding of core networking services, security practices, common network attacks, and effective defense strategies. By the end, you'll be well-prepared to handle network issues and ensure secure operations in diverse network environments.

Starting with an introduction to network services like DNS, NTP, and PTP, the course guides you through essential network functionalities. You'll then explore key concepts in network security, focusing on encryption, IAM, and various authentication types. The course continues by detailing common network attacks, including DoS, VLAN hopping, ARP poisoning, and DNS spoofing, providing insights into preventing these threats.

You will also learn how to implement robust network defense strategies such as device hardening, NAC, key management, and honeypot techniques. Practical troubleshooting skills are a major focus, with lessons on resolving cable, interface, hardware, and wireless issues, alongside using powerful tools like iPerf and OS-level commands.

This course is perfect for aspiring network professionals and those preparing for certification exams like Network+. It is ideal for individuals seeking hands-on experience with network security, troubleshooting, and exam prep, with no advanced prior knowledge required.

Network Services
In this module, we will cover essential network services like DNS, NTP, and PTP, and explore how time synchronization and hostname resolution contribute to network stability and security.
